The role:
Operating across all functions of PNO’s core consultancy business, this is a client facing role that will involve:
- Working with clients to qualify their ideas for alignment to available funding programmes and the proactive scanning of new grant opportunities for strategic projects. This will extend across a range of industry sectors including ICT, energy, environment, transport, chemistry, biotechnology and health, and depending on the background of the successful candidate, there will be opportunity to specialize in a particular technology domain.
- Once an opportunity for funding has been identified, conduct primary research including market analysis and literature/patent searches to qualify the competitive landscape and true innovation of a particular idea.
- Working directly with the client to prepare high quality grant applications. This will include innovation project scoping, the compilation of information required for the submission, and writing of the grant proposal covering all aspects of information required by a grantor body from the analysis of the business and market opportunity available, the advancement beyond current technologies offered, the innovation, route to market strategy and impact.
- Working with the client to prepare documents for the grant agreement, reports and claims to comply with the Grantor body requirements.
